Tom's Adirondack Birthday Adventure

Here is where the adventure began- one kayak, one patched-up canoe, and six eager passengers going to Old Forge, NY.

The kayak/canoe business drove us in our van to the drop off point on the Moose River and then they drove our van back to the parking lot, where our trip would end. (For all of my Frugal Hack friends, it was a $12 shuttle fee. :) A very full kayak and canoe

We found a sandbar for the birthday party picnic.

Chicken salad sandwiches, a new pasta salad recipe, Doritos (a treat since I never buy them), M&M's (because Hubby loves them), grapes and a pineapple cheesecake (because that is what he always wants).

IBC Rootbeer is another treat.

The birthday boy
The trip was supposed to be 3-4 hours. But when you stop to have a birthday picnic, swim, stop again for birthday cheesecake, swim some more, take pictures of flora, and just pause to enjoy the day, it takes close to 6 hours!
